Skip to content


Subversion checkout URL

You can clone with
Download ZIP
Browse files

Added a note about __HASTE__ and __HASTE_TCE__ to the readme.

  • Loading branch information...
commit 73fecb0793463cc5cda2282d93dd5a1a09c560fb 1 parent 34cb028
@valderman authored
Showing with 5 additions and 0 deletions.
  1. +5 −0
@@ -47,6 +47,11 @@ You can pass the same flags to hastec as you'd normally pass to GHC:
Haste also has its own set of command line arguments. Invoke it with --help to
read more about them.
+If you want your package to compile with both Haste and, say, GHC, you might
+want to use the CPP extension for conditional compilation. Haste defines the
+preprocessor symbol __HASTE__ for all modules it compiles, and __HASTE_TCE__
+for those compiled with full trampolining tail call elimination.
Reactive web EDSL

0 comments on commit 73fecb0

Please sign in to comment.
Something went wrong with that request. Please try again.